Spring weather doesn’t kick in right away. Enjoy the ski season through mid to late April and experience the unique perks of spring skiing. Spring offers warmer temperatures and more sunlight, so that you can enjoy more time on the slopes and softer snow. Enjoy discounted lift tickets at the end of the ski season!
Soak up the warm spring weather at Vail’s restaurants featuring outdoor patios. Whether you are looking for an apres-ski spot near the slopes or a casual place to unwind after a hike, there is an option for everyone. Some of our favorites include Garfinkel’s in Lionshead Village or Alpenrose in Vail Village.
By late spring, popular recreational activities begin to reopen. Dress in layers and start exploring lower-elevation hiking trails, such as the Gore Valley Trail or the Booth Falls Trail. Or go fly-fishing on Gore Creek. By May, summer activities like mountain biking, whitewater rafting, and golfing will be in full swing.
Fun and exciting events are available in Vail year-round. The season kicks off with the annual Taste of Vail event, where you can sample world-class food and wine from local chefs and winemakers. By the end of May, the free summer concerts at Gerald R. Ford Amphitheater kick off. Check the event schedule and join the festivities during your spring vacation in Colorado.
Spring weather can be unpredictable. If it’s rainy or snowy during your visit, there’s plenty of fun to be had indoors. Reserve a revitalizing spa treatment at one of our local spas, learn about our history at local museums, find a souvenir at a local boutique, browse art at galleries, go bowling, and enjoy a delicious meal at our restaurants.
Spring is one of the most unpredictable seasons here in the Colorado Mountains. On one day it could be 30 degrees and snowing, while the next day it’s 60 degrees and sunny. Dining out in Vail, Colorado, is more than just a meal; it’s a culinary adventure. Make a reservation at some of the best restaurants in Vail and enjoy cuisine from countries like Japan, Germany, and France. Whether you are looking for a romantic fine-dining experience or a laidback apres-ski cocktail spot, there is an eatery for everyone’s interests!
If you are looking for the best breakfast in town, look no further than The Little Diner. This locally owned and operated restaurant serves all-day breakfast, featuring breakfast classics and regional specialties, such as omelets, crepes, pancakes, breakfast sandwiches, and breakfast platters. Watch your food be prepared in the open kitchen and start the day with a hearty breakfast!
Dine at Alpenrose Vail for delicious German and Austrian cuisine in the mountains. Try classics like goulash, dumpling specialties, Kässpätzle, schnitzel, and bratwurst. Pair your meal with Bavarian beer, wine, or cocktails for the perfect addition. During the winter, they offer special gondola dining, where you can dine on a private gondola with your closest friends and family!
Mountain Standard specializes in wood-fired dishes that embody the essence of the Rockies. Enjoy a wide variety of dishes during lunch or dinner, including oysters, wood-fired pork chops, and sandwiches. Make sure to order one of their seasonally crafted cocktails. Dine outside during the warmer months and enjoy views of Gore Creek as you eat your meal.
Plan a date night at Mirabelle and enjoy delicious French cuisine in an intimate and romantic setting. The menu changes seasonally, utilizing fresh ingredients from the on-site garden and greenhouse. From roasted elk tenderloin to yellowfin tuna steak, they offer something for everyone’s taste buds.
Make a reservation at Swiss Chalet and enjoy traditional European cuisine in a classic Swiss-style setting. They are known for their cheese fondues, made with several Swiss cheeses and served with potatoes, vegetables, and baguette bread for dipping. This is a great place to warm up after a day of skiing.
Stop at Osaki’s for traditional Japanese cuisine and sushi. They offer a special menu every night, featuring fresh fish from Japan and a selection of sake. Check their social media to see what’s on the menu during your visit.

Vail may be known for its epic skiing, but beyond the slopes, our mountain town offers an impressive culinary scene. During your getaway with Berkshire Hathaway HomeServices Colorado Properties, we invite you to try the best sushi in Vail. From the Michelin-recognized Osaki’s to Matsuhisa, created by a renowned chef, here are the top places to get sushi around Vail:
Matsuhisa, in the heart of Vail Village, is owned and operated by renowned Chef Nobu. Chef Nobu draws influences from his training around the world to create a one-of-a-kind menu. The restaurant features sushi and sashimi, including its signature yellowtail sashimi with jalapeno. Enjoy the cozy atmosphere and mountain views during your meal!
Enjoy the intimate setting of Yama Sushi while enjoying sophisticated Japanese sushi, including nigiri, sashimi, yasai, and maki. Pair your sushi with a specialty cocktail!
Osaki’s is committed to providing the finest Japanese cuisine in Vail, handpicking the freshest quality fish daily. The menu changes daily based on what fish the restaurant receives from Japan. Check the menu on Osaki’s YouTube channel before your visit!
Hooked Beaver Creek is known for its combination of fresh seafood and Rocky Mountain cuisine. Seafood is flown into the restaurant within 24 hours of being pulled from the ocean. Fish varies daily, but they offer a whole fish menu where you can customize your meal as rolls, nigiri, or sashimi.
Nozawa offers fresh and authentic Asian cuisine in Avon. Choose from a wide variety of nigiri or sashimi, or order their special Nozawa roll.
